Understanding a Sample Quotation Air Conditioner

A sample quotation air conditioner is a detailed estimate provided by suppliers or contractors outlining the costs associated with purchasing, installing, and maintaining an air conditioning system. It serves as a transparent document that helps clients compare different offers and make the best choice based on their needs and budget.

What Does a Typical Air Conditioner Quotation Include?

A comprehensive quotation generally covers:

  • Equipment Costs
  • Price of the air conditioning unit (split, window, central, etc.)
  • Accessories and additional components (filters, vents, thermostats)
  • Installation Fees
  • Labor charges
  • Material costs (wiring, piping, mounting brackets)
  • Testing and commissioning
  • Maintenance and Warranty
  • Service packages
  • Warranty duration and coverage
  • Other Expenses
  • Delivery charges
  • Permits or regulatory fees

Factors Affecting the Cost in an Air Conditioner Quotation

Understanding what influences the quotation helps you assess the value of the offer and avoid overpaying. Key factors include:

Type of Air Conditioner

  • Split System: Suitable for individual rooms; moderate cost.
  • Window Units: Cost-effective for small spaces; lower installation complexity.
  • Central Air Conditioning: Ideal for whole-house cooling; higher upfront investment.
  • Portable Units: Flexible but less efficient; lower initial cost.

Cooling Capacity (BTU or Tons)

  • The larger the space, the higher the BTU or tonnage required, which directly impacts the price.
  • Proper sizing ensures efficiency and avoids unnecessary expenses.

Brand and Quality

  • Premium brands often come with higher prices but offer better durability and features.
  • Budget brands may be cheaper but could incur higher maintenance costs.

Installation Complexity

  • Factors like building structure, accessibility, and existing infrastructure influence installation costs.
  • Complex installations may require additional labor or materials.

Additional Features and Technologies

  • Inverter Technology: Saves energy but adds to initial costs.
  • Smart Controls: Wi-Fi enabled units may have higher prices.
  • Air Purification: Integrated filters or UV sanitizers increase cost.

Warranty and Service Packages

  • Longer and comprehensive warranties often increase quotation figures but reduce long-term expenses.

Types of Air Conditioning Systems and Their Sample Quotations

Different systems suit varying needs and budgets. Here’s a breakdown:

Split Air Conditioners

  • Description: Consist of indoor and outdoor units.
  • Ideal For: Single rooms or small spaces.
  • Sample Quotation Highlights:
  • Price range: $300 - $800 per unit (depending on capacity).
  • Installation costs: $150 - $300.
  • Maintenance: Annual service starting at $50.

Window Air Conditioners

  • Description: Compact units installed in window frames.
  • Ideal For: Apartments or small offices.
  • Sample Quotation Highlights:
  • Price range: $200 - $600.
  • Installation: Usually included or minimal.
  • Maintenance: Inexpensive but limited lifespan.

Central Air Conditioning Systems

  • Description: Whole-building cooling with ductwork.
  • Ideal For: Large homes, commercial buildings.
  • Sample Quotation Highlights:
  • Price range: $3,000 - $15,000+ depending on capacity.
  • Installation costs: $1,000 - $5,000.
  • Maintenance: Regular service contracts.

Portable Air Conditioners

  • Description: Mobile units that can be moved around.
  • Ideal For: Temporary cooling solutions.
  • Sample Quotation Highlights:
  • Price range: $200 - $700.
  • Installation: Minimal.
  • Maintenance: Low.

Case Study: Comparing Two Sample Quotations

Suppose you receive two quotations for a 1.5-ton split inverter air conditioner:

Quotation A:

  • Brand: CoolAir
  • Price: $700
  • Installation: $150
  • Warranty: 3 years
  • Features: Inverter technology, air purification
  • Total: $850

Quotation B:

  • Brand: ChillMaster
  • Price: $650
  • Installation: $200 (due to complex piping)
  • Warranty: 2 years
  • Features: Non-inverter, basic cooling
  • Total: $850

Analysis:

While the total costs are similar, Quotation A offers better energy efficiency and longer warranty. The choice depends on your priorities—cost versus quality and long-term savings.
